How to Get the Best Deals on Harmony of the Seas Cruises

How to Get the Best Deals on Harmony of the Seas Cruises
A cruise vacation on Harmony of the Seas can be an unforgettable experience, but finding the best deals can help you enjoy luxury at a more affordable price. Whether you’re a first-time cruiser or a seasoned traveler, these tips will help you save money while booking your next adventure.
1. Book Early for the Best Prices
- Royal Caribbean often releases cruise schedules 12-18 months in advance, and prices tend to be lower at this stage.
- Early bookings allow you to choose the best cabins and secure lower rates before demand increases.
- Look for early-bird discounts and promotional offers.
2. Take Advantage of Last-Minute Deals
- If you have a flexible schedule, booking a cruise a few weeks before departure can result in major savings.
- Check Royal Caribbean’s website, travel agencies, and deal websites for last-minute discounts.
- Be open to different cabin types and itineraries to maximize savings.
3. Be Flexible with Your Travel Dates
- Cruises departing during off-peak seasons (September to early December and January to February) tend to have lower prices.
- Mid-week departures (Tuesdays and Wednesdays) can also be more affordable compared to weekend sailings.
4. Use a Travel Agent or Cruise Specialist
- Travel agents often have access to exclusive discounts, onboard credits, and special perks.
- Some agencies offer group rates and package deals that are not available to the general public.
5. Look for Cruise Sales and Promotions
- Royal Caribbean frequently offers limited-time promotions, such as BOGO (Buy One, Get One) deals and kids sail free offers.
- Sign up for Royal Caribbean’s newsletter to stay informed about upcoming sales.
- Follow social media accounts and deal forums for flash sales and promo codes.
6. Consider an Interior or Guaranteed Cabin
- If you’re more concerned with budget than cabin type, interior staterooms are the most affordable option.
- Booking a “guaranteed cabin” means you let the cruise line assign your room, which can lead to unexpected upgrades at a lower cost.
7. Take Advantage of Onboard Credit Offers
- Some travel agencies and promotions offer onboard credits that can be used for specialty dining, spa treatments, and excursions.
- Compare deals with and without onboard credits to determine the best overall value.
8. Use Loyalty Programs and Discounts
- If you’ve sailed with Royal Caribbean before, join the Crown & Anchor Society for exclusive member discounts.
- Military, senior citizen, and resident discounts may also be available.
9. Bundle with Flights and Hotels
- Booking a cruise package that includes flights and pre-cruise hotel stays can sometimes be cheaper than purchasing separately.
- Look for bundle deals offered directly by Royal Caribbean or through third-party travel agencies.
10. Avoid Unnecessary Fees
- Plan excursions independently instead of booking through the cruise line to save money.
- Be mindful of onboard spending, including specialty dining, drinks, and gratuities.
- Consider bringing your own allowed beverages to avoid costly bar tabs.
